Adobe is seeking a dynamic and strategic Sales Manager to lead and manage a team of Partner Sales Managers in driving growth through Adobe’s DX Partner ecosystem – consisting of Global System Integrators, Agencies and Regional Partners/Boutiques This role will report into our Director of Partner Sales for the UKI MEA Region . This role is critical in accelerating partner-led and co-sell revenue, fostering strategic initiatives, and ensuring operational excellence in tracking and enhancing partner performance metrics. The ideal candidate will have strong leadership skills, experience of working with GSIs/Agencies/ Boutiques, a deep understanding of partnersales motions, and experience managing co-creation strategies with partners to deliver scalable business outcomes. Executive Relationship management is key along with Skills to engage with Partner St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ities:
Team Leadership & People Management:
• Lead, mentor, and develop a high-performing team of Partner Sales Managers, ensuring alignment with Adobe’s partner strategy.
• Establish clear performance goals, provide ongoing coaching, and drive accountability across the team.
• Foster a culture of collaboration, innovation, and results-driven execution within the partner sales organization.
• Work closely with and Deputize for Director of Partner Sales as and when needed, take active role in working with Director to optimize Strategy for the Partner function and closing business.
Partner Sales Strategy & Execution:
• Develop and execute a comprehensive partnersalesstrategy to drive partner-led and co-sell revenue growth within The Solution Led DX Business.
• Oversee partner co-creation motions, ensuring successful joint solutions, campaigns, and go-tomarket (GTM) initiatives.
• Align partnerstrategies with Adobe’s broadersales and marketing objectivesto maximize impact.
• Identify and cultivate relationships with key strategic partnersto drive mutual business success.
Lead cross-functional collaboration with Adobe’s direct salesteams, marketing, and product teams to enhance partner engagement and joint value propositions.
Performance Metrics & Reporting:
• Track and optimize partnersales performance metrics, including partner-sourced and co-sell revenue, pipeline contribution, and deal velocity.
• Leverage data-driven insightsto refine partner engagementstrategies and improve sales outcomes.
• Ensure visibility into partner-led opportunities and influence key business decisions through robust reporting. Ensure All Sales hygiene is adhered to in timely & accurate fashion
Required Qualifications:
• 5+ years of experience in direct sales and/ or partnersalesleadership, or indirectsales, preferably in enterprise software/SaaS.
• Proven track record of managing high-performing salesteams and achieving/exceeding revenue targets.
• Strong experience in partner co-sell, partner-led sales, and strategic partner management.
• Ability to analyze sales data, track key performance metrics, and drive data-driven decisionmaking.
• Exceptionalstakeholder management and ability to influence cross-functional teams.
• Strong communication, presentation, and negotiation skills.
• Experience working with Adobe’s ecosystem orsimilar technology environmentsis a plus.
